HBAN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2018 in Review

679 of the 4,374 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Huntington Bancshares (HBAN) for Q3 2018, worth a combined $12.3B — up 1.3% from $12.1B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 83 funds opened new HBAN positions and 54 closed out — a net gain of 29 holders — while 236 added to existing stakes and 214 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Amundi Asset Management US, adding an estimated $37M. The largest seller was Capital International Investors, cutting an estimated $106M.
